Diabetes also has a strong association with gum illness. 2 Developing healthy routines early in a kid's life is important for their overall well-being. Primary teeth, even though they're temporary, assist a child consume, talk, and smile. They likewise function as placeholders that assist their permanent teeth can be found in properly. WebMD alerts, for example, about" baby-bottle tooth decay"- a typical issue for children getting their very first set of teeth. Putting a child to bed with a bottle filled with sugary liquids, like juice or soda, can rot their teeth. Caretakers can avoid this by serving only formula, milk or breast milk in bottles. Primary teeth ought to be cleaned up with a washcloth. Young children must ultimately have their teeth and tongues brushed with soft toothbrushes. Kids need to discover the appropriate method to brush their teeth utilizing fluoride toothpaste. Regular dental check-ups must likewise become part of their regimen. Although the advancement of plaque is a natural procedure, this can really harm your teeth and cause more problems in the long run. Tartar or dental calculus is plaque.
that has actually calcified on the teeth. Tartar traps discolorations, creates staining, and makes it more difficult to eliminate bacteria and plaque. This develops a bond that can just be eliminated by a dental professional and can be pricey. By not brushing twice a day, you are more likely to have plaque start to form on the teeth which leads to gum disease. The signs of gum illness are things like agonizing chewing,.
sore gums, delicate teeth, bad breath that won't disappear, and so on. Gum disease is avoidable by taking precautions and staying up to date with fundamental dental hygiene. All that growth requires lots of good nutrients, which applies to teeth and gums as well. So what are the most crucial vitamins and minerals moms and dads should make certain their kids are getting to develop those healthy smiles? You probably saw this one coming, however calcium is the number one mineral needed for building and keeping strong, healthy teeth.
Magnesium is a mineral that plays an essential role in teeth and bone health, because it assists the body absorb calcium. Great sources of magnesium consist of nuts, beans, seeds, whole grains, and dark, leafy veggies. Saliva is the first line of defense against gum disease and tooth decay, and.

Chicken and fish are good sources of vitamin B3, vitamin B12 can be discovered in pasta, bagels, spinach, and almonds, and vitamin B2 remains in red meat, chicken, liver, fish, and dairy products. Without vitamin D, other important vitamins and minerals, consisting of calcium, would not do us much good. Vitamin D signifies our intestinal tracts to absorb calcium into the bloodstream.
Your child can get vitamin D from eggs, fish, and dairy products, Iron helps deliver oxygen to our cells.
